Turkish University Program Summer Session Appointments Approved It was moved by Regent Adkins, seconded by Regent Elliott, motion put to vote and caried, that the following summer session appointments be approved as recommended by the Chancellor's office. SUMMER SESSION Teachers College School Administration University High School Retirements Approved It was moved by Regent Foote, seconded by Regent Welsh, motion put to vote and carried, that the following retirements be approved as recommended by the Chancellor's office. RETIREMENT Mary E. Baade, Maid at Terrace Hall, at $45.47 per year, single life, effective June 1, 1959. Kenneth Forward, Associate Professor Emeritus of English, at $797.07 per year, joint and survivorship, effective July 1, 1959. Etta Keane, Assistant Buyer in Purchasing at $915.29 per year, single life, effective July 1, 1959. Carrie M. Krisl, Maid at Selleck Quadrangle, at $62.22 per year, single life, effective July 1, 1959. Edgar F. Stalder, Custodian, Buildings and Grounds, at $144.05 per year, joint and survivorship, effective July 1, 1959. Fred Teply, Greenhouse Foreman, Plant Pathology, at $243.43 per year, joint and survivorship, effective July 1, 1959. Death Recorded From the Chancellor's office comes a report of the death of a retired staff member. It was moved by Regent Adkins, and seconded by Regent Foote, motion put to vote and carried, that this death be made a matter of record in these minutes and the University payrolls adjusted accordingly.
